Product Number | U0030 |
Purity / Analysis Method ![]() |
>98.0%(T) |
Molecular Formula / Molecular Weight | C__2__4H__4__0O__4 = 392.58 |
Physical State (20 deg.C) | Solid |
Storage Temperature ![]() |
Room Temperature (Recommended in a cool and dark place, <15°C) |
CAS RN | 128-13-2 |
Reaxys Registry Number | 3219888 |
PubChem Substance ID | 87577760 |
SDBS (AIST Spectral DB) | 11242 |
Merck Index (14) | 9889 |
MDL Number | MFCD00003680 |
Appearance | White to Almost white powder to crystaline |
Purity(Neutralization titration) | min. 98.0 %(after drying) |
Melting point | 200.0 to 205.0 °C |
Specific rotation [a]20/D | + 59.0 to + 62.0 deg(C=4, EtOH) |
Solubility in EtOH | almost transparency |
Drying loss | max. 1.0 % |
Melting Point | 203 °C |
Specific Rotation | 60.5° (C=4,EtOH) |
Solubility in water | Insoluble |
Degree of solubility in water | 20 mg/l 20 °C |
Solubility (slightly sol. in) | Chloroform |
RTECS# | FZ2000000 |
